Transaction e780102f6bc69f5f95144e255d5727f5036e63cd749364ff8a7bac08a7553afe
1 Input
1 Output
-
e780102f6bc69f5f95144e255d5727f5036e63cd749364ff8a7bac08a7553afe:0
- value
- 695836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d12002fcc27f68021e5d3f488598aa96e46213 OP_EQUAL
- address
- 3EFj262LYyM7fL2CRahDccEsnst5YxqqwY